CELL CAPACITY The amount of electrical energy that a cell can provide from new to the end of its useful voltage on load is called the cell capacity and is quoted in Ampere hour

Uses of Radar: Radar is used to locate and recognize war planes and missiles, to guide ships or submarine to see position of a satellite in space.
